Cigar Lei

The Cigar lei is made from the tube like flowers of the Cuphea Ignia shrub which are fiery red and orange in color. Each tiny tube is ringed with grey, then white at the tip, like a miniature burning cigar. The Cigar lei is long-lasting and a marvel of the lei maker’s work. These leis are strung in intricate patterns that resemble fine Indian beadwork. This design won the “Most beautiful Lei” in 1928.

Firecracker Lei

The Firecracker lei is popular for its dazzling deep red-orange hues. The flowers are strung back-and-forth using approximately 500 inch-long flowers.

Kukui Nut Lei

The kukui nut lei is a lei of pride and bravery. It is usually worn by men to signify these two characteristics. The kukui nuts are hand picked, sun dried, then finally stained a golden brown to bring out its true colors. *leaves in the middle of each nut is optional and has an additional cost* The Kukui Nut Lei is available in brown or black. Haku Lei

Meant to be worn on the head. Haku actually refers to the method of securing the flowers and foliage "presentation style" to the base of the lei. The construction is sturdy and travels well. The haku lei is also available in white. Please choose color below.

Rope Crown Flower Lei

The stylish Crown Flower (Puakalaunu) was Hawaiiian Queen Liliuokalani’s favorite. The enduring blossom was thought to resemble the royal crown, thus, its American namesake. Although a native of India, Hawaii has embraced this regal flower as a local favorite for it’s milky white and lavender colors. Our rope-style Crown Flower Lei is sewn using over 200 center blossoms (crown) and over 300 exterior petals. If properly handled, this hardy lei can last up to a week and can be worn many times.

Kukuna O Ka La Lei

The mangroves that produce the material for the lei kukuna-o-ka-la were introduced to Hawai'i in 1922. The stiff yellow to red calyxes resembling the rays of the sun, are gathered from trees that grow at the mouths of streams in brackish water during the later summer and through the fall when they are plentiful. Appreciation increases when one discovers the lei kukuna-o-ka-la will keep well for more than a week and is even wearable after it is completely dried.
